Output bd20f95aeb238e0a21cc5f964d17d9505119358cb53ab9fe57b88caf9b3f39bd:0

value
1142976682
script pubkey
OP_0 OP_PUSHBYTES_20 e9ca05f8b8306a65d39b5175e8fb6654559d4ff9
address
ltc1qa89qt79cxp4xt5um296737mx232e6nlerj3z93
transaction
bd20f95aeb238e0a21cc5f964d17d9505119358cb53ab9fe57b88caf9b3f39bd
spent
true